Troops recover cache of arms in Imo forest raid

Troops of Operation UDO KA have raided a forest in Imo State and arrested a suspected key armourer and logistics courier linked to attacks on oil installations and security forces.
The Nigerian Army disclosed this in a statement posted on its official X handle on Thursday, noting that it also recovered a substantial cache of arms and ammunition during an intelligence-led operation.
The statement disclosed that acting on credible intelligence, troops conducted a deliberate search and raid operation along the Akpe Aggah–Egbema Forest axis in the early hours of 1 July 2026, leading to the arrest of a suspected armourer and logistics kingpin at Obiakpu Forest.
According to the statement, preliminary findings indicate that the suspect served as the principal armourer for the criminal group responsible for attacks against oil installations and troops deployed in the Ohaji–Egbema area.
The army further revealed that the operation led to the recovery of a significant cache of weapons and ammunition, including one AK-47 rifle, one M4A1 carbine, one M16A2 rifle, six magazines, five pump-action guns, a locally fabricated pistol and a large quantity of assorted ammunition.
“The recovery represents a major disruption to the group’s operational capability and logistics chain.
“The suspect is currently in custody and will undergo further investigation to facilitate follow-on operations aimed at identifying, apprehending and dismantling other members and collaborators of the criminal network,” the army said.
